Initial Server Setup

1. First-time Server Configuration

Run the initial server setup (only once on fresh server):

cd deployment/infrastructure

# Run initial setup as root user
ansible-playbook -i inventories/production/hosts.yml setup-fresh-server.yml

This will:

  • Create the deploy user with sudo privileges
  • Configure SSH key authentication
  • Harden SSH security
  • Set up firewall (UFW)
  • Configure fail2ban
  • Install essential packages
  • Create directory structure

2. Update Inventory Configuration

After initial setup, update inventories/production/hosts.yml:

# Change from:
ansible_user: root
fresh_server_setup: true

# To:
ansible_user: deploy
fresh_server_setup: false

3. Full Infrastructure Deployment

Deploy the complete infrastructure:

# Deploy infrastructure only
ansible-playbook -i inventories/production/hosts.yml site.yml

# Or use the orchestration script
./deploy.sh production --infrastructure-only

Deployment Process

Full Deployment

Deploy both infrastructure and application:

./deploy.sh production

Infrastructure Only

Deploy only the infrastructure (server setup, Nginx, Docker, etc.):

./deploy.sh production --infrastructure-only

Application Only

Deploy only the application code:

./deploy.sh production --application-only

Dry Run

Test deployment without making changes:

./deploy.sh production --dry-run

Security Considerations

SSH Access

  • Root login disabled after initial setup
  • Only deploy user has access
  • SSH key authentication required
  • Password authentication disabled

Firewall Rules

  • Only ports 22 (SSH), 80 (HTTP), 443 (HTTPS) open
  • UFW configured with default deny
  • Fail2ban protecting SSH

SSL/TLS

  • Let's Encrypt SSL certificates
  • HTTPS enforced
  • Modern TLS configuration (TLS 1.2/1.3)
  • HSTS headers

Security Updates

Regular Maintenance

  1. Update system packages monthly
  2. Review fail2ban logs for suspicious activity
  3. Monitor SSL certificate expiration
  4. Check for security updates

Update Commands

# Update system packages
sudo apt update && sudo apt upgrade -y

# Update Docker containers
cd /var/www/html
docker-compose pull
docker-compose up -d

# Renew SSL certificates (automatic with certbot)
sudo certbot renew

Recovery Procedures

Rollback Deployment

If issues occur:

# Stop application
docker-compose down

# Restore from backup
sudo rsync -av /var/www/backups/latest/ /var/www/html/

# Restart application
docker-compose up -d

Emergency Access

If SSH key issues occur:

  1. Access via Netcup VPS console
  2. Re-enable password authentication temporarily
  3. Fix SSH key configuration
  4. Disable password authentication again
